Heartlake Pet Salon lands in Mixed Reviews territory with a BrickScore of 60.4, reflecting a genuine split between critics and casual buyers. The Brickset reviewer gave it a 40 and found it lukewarm, criticizing a jarring color scheme and an unclear identity split between salon and pet shop. JANG rated it 80 and found the design genuinely good, praising the rotating grooming table and interchangeable accessory system. Owner ratings (4.73 out of 5 across 16 ratings) skew positive, aligning more with JANG's take than the Brickset reviewer's, though the small owner sample limits confidence in that signal.
Where they split: The Brickset reviewer awarded a 40 and actively recommended skipping the set, citing the disjointed color scheme and identity confusion as fundamental flaws. JANG gave it an 80 and considered it genuinely well-designed with good playability. Owner ratings (4.73 out of 5) broadly sided with JANG, though the sample of only 16 ratings keeps that split worth noting.
